SHSP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2020 in Review
54 of the 5,652 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in SharpSpring, Inc. (SHSP) for Q4 2020, worth a combined $145M — up 90% from $76.3M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 18 funds opened new SHSP positions and 3 closed out — a net gain of 15 holders — while 22 added to existing stakes and 12 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Wellington Management Group, adding an estimated $10.1M. The largest seller was Cat Rock Capital Management, cutting an estimated $4.15M.
